Exploring the Health Debate: How unhealthy is fake-meat?

5 min read

According to the NOVA food classification system, many popular fake meat products are categorized as ultra-processed foods. This raises a critical question for health-conscious consumers: How unhealthy is fake-meat when it relies on industrial processing rather than whole food ingredients?

The Ultra-Processed Problem

The most significant concern surrounding modern fake meat products is their status as ultra-processed foods (UPFs). These products are defined not by their ingredients alone, but by the industrial techniques used to create them. To achieve a texture, flavor, and appearance that convincingly mimics animal meat, manufacturers combine isolated proteins, fats, flavorings, and various additives through industrial processes like extrusion. For example, the Beyond Burger has around 21 ingredients, and the Impossible Burger uses a genetically engineered yeast to produce soy leghemoglobin to simulate the 'bleed' of real meat. In contrast, a simple beef patty has one ingredient.

While processing is not inherently bad (e.g., canning beans), the extent of processing in fake meat has raised red flags. Some studies link high UPF consumption to greater risks of cardiovascular disease, type 2 diabetes, and other health issues. While fake meat is just one type of UPF, relying heavily on it may displace healthier, less-processed whole foods like legumes, grains, and vegetables.

Common Additives in Fake Meat

  • Methylcellulose: A plant-based compound derived from wood pulp, it acts as a binder and emulsifier to help create the desired texture and mouthfeel.
  • Yeast Extract: Used as a flavor enhancer, it provides an umami taste and may contribute to the product's high sodium levels.
  • Natural Flavors: This broad category can include a wide variety of proprietary and often undisclosed flavor compounds to imitate the taste of meat.
  • Refined Oils: Seed oils like canola, coconut, or sunflower oil are often used to replicate the fat content of meat, which can be high in saturated fat depending on the formulation.
  • Soy Leghemoglobin: A specific additive developed by Impossible Foods using genetic engineering to provide a meaty flavor and color.

A Nutritional Comparison: Fake Meat vs. Real Meat

While fake meat aims to replicate the experience of animal meat, its nutritional composition is distinct, with different strengths and weaknesses. The following table compares a popular fake meat burger to a standard beef patty, highlighting key differences. Keep in mind that formulations are constantly evolving.

Nutrient Impossible Burger (4oz) Beyond Burger (4oz) 85% Lean Ground Beef (4oz) Commentary
Calories 240 230 240 Generally comparable, but can vary by brand.
Total Fat 14g 18g 17g Varies by specific formulation. Beyond uses coconut oil, contributing to its saturated fat.
Saturated Fat 8g 5g 6g Can be lower in fake meat, but some products can be similar or higher than lean beef.
Cholesterol 0mg 0mg 80mg Fake meat contains no dietary cholesterol, a clear advantage for those limiting intake.
Sodium 370mg 390mg 80mg A major drawback. Fake meat is significantly higher in sodium to enhance flavor.
Carbohydrates 9g 7g 0g Present in fake meat due to starches and fillers; absent in real beef.
Dietary Fiber 3g 2g 0g A key advantage of fake meat, which adds fiber from its plant-based ingredients.
Protein 19g 20g 21g Comparable protein levels, but bioavailability may differ.
B12 Fortified Fortified Natural source Fake meat often needs to be fortified as the nutrients aren't naturally present.
Iron Fortified Fortified Natural source Similar to B12, often added synthetically.

Potential Health Impacts and Long-Term Considerations

The immediate benefits of choosing fake meat over red meat often cited are the lower cholesterol and sometimes lower saturated fat content. However, these benefits must be viewed in the broader context of a person's diet. Replacing a fatty beef burger with an equally high-calorie, high-sodium fake meat burger that is served on a white bread bun with sugary sauce and fries may not offer a significant health upgrade.

Furthermore, the long-term health effects of regularly consuming ultra-processed fake meats are not yet fully understood. While short-term studies have shown promising results, such as lower cholesterol and weight loss in some groups, long-term independent research is limited. Some research suggests a potential link between UPF consumption and increased inflammation and even depression, particularly in vegetarians who rely heavily on these products, though more investigation is needed.

Additionally, the bioavailability of certain nutrients is a consideration. Minerals like iron and zinc derived from plant-based sources may be less readily absorbed by the body compared to those from animal sources. The presence of anti-nutritional factors (ANFs) in plant proteins can further hinder absorption.

Making a Healthier Choice

For those seeking a healthier diet, fake meat products can serve a purpose as a "steppingstone" away from heavy red meat consumption. They satisfy cravings for meat-like textures and flavors, easing the transition to a more plant-forward diet. However, for maximum nutritional benefit, fake meat should not be seen as a perfect substitute for whole plant-based foods.

To make a healthier choice, consider the following:

  • Prioritize whole foods: Opt for minimally processed protein sources like lentils, beans, tofu, tempeh, and whole grains. They are naturally rich in fiber, vitamins, and minerals without the high sodium or additives.
  • Read the label: If you do choose fake meat, compare the nutritional information of different brands. Look for options with lower sodium and saturated fat content.
  • Cook at home: Preparing your own meals allows for complete control over ingredients, including sodium levels. A homemade black bean or lentil burger will be far less processed than a store-bought version.
  • Use it in moderation: Use fake meat sparingly rather than as a dietary staple. Treat it as a treat, similar to how one might view processed meat.
  • Vary your protein: Diversify your protein sources to ensure you get a full spectrum of nutrients. A vegetarian or vegan diet should not rely solely on processed meat alternatives.

Conclusion

Is fake meat unhealthy? The answer is nuanced. Compared to unprocessed animal meat, fake meat is typically much higher in sodium and is classified as ultra-processed. It may also have lower bioavailability of certain micronutrients unless heavily fortified. However, compared to processed red meat, some fake meat versions may offer benefits like lower saturated fat and no cholesterol. The health implications largely depend on the specific product, the overall diet, and how frequently it is consumed. While fake meat can help reduce red meat consumption, it is not a health elixir. For optimal health, they are best viewed as an occasional transition food, with the foundation of a healthy diet built upon whole, minimally processed plant foods like beans, lentils, and vegetables.
